April 27, 2006The Australian Slippery SlopeAustralia already has some of the strictest gun control laws in the world. Centerfire rifles and shotguns are banned (with rare exceptions for some sporting purposes) and handguns are restricted to sporting club members with an arduous, multiple-stage licensing procedure and highly regulated storage requirements. Naturally, criminals bypass all these laws and licenses. And today, Prime Minister Howard is proposing further restrictions:
Since "legitimate sporting shooters" are pretty much the only ones who have them now, and only one-tenth of one percent of illegal guns seized by cops there came from (read: Were stolen from) legal owners, what is there left to ban?
